Portrayal Of A Face

As our eyes met, she frowned at me unfeelingly. Her brow arched like the wood of a bow and the arrows were her piercing eyes. They stared distantly at me, large and green like a cat's, caressed with sadistic black rings. The pupils were large and dilated as if there was no light, but the sun spat rays that kissed her pale skin; a snow white tan that showed all too many flaws. Scars and blemishes danced upon her flesh, her ugly face. Though, on account that her head skewed forward as if in shame and mortification, she knew this. Her nose was of German origin, thickset like a pumpkin and ended with a disk-shaped needle head. Her cheeks were round and showed no shadow belonging to cheekbones- her skin was too thick for it. Two lines made-up her thin lips, whitened from her foundation and cracked like dirt in the Arizona heat. Her jawbone was barely visible, as well as her chin, due to the obesity surrounding it.
